Clonlara School is seeking a full time high school math/science teacher. We are an independent K-12 situated in Ann Arbor, Michigan. We believe students learn best when they can take ownership of their education while having guidance from close mentors. We focus on three main educational pillars. We provide the student with the autonomy to follow their innate strengths, talents, interests, and curiosities; we develop deep relationships between the student and their peers, faculty, family, and surrounding community; and we challenge the student to gain competence for whatever future they desire.
